> RU should check for INSTALL_FAILED components before starting
> --------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: AMBARI-13420
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/AMBARI-13420
> Project: Ambari
> Issue Type: Bug
> Components: ambari-server
> Affects Versions: 2.1.2
> Reporter: Jayush Luniya
> Assignee: Jayush Luniya
> Fix For: 2.1.3
>
> Attachments: AMBARI-13420.patch
>
>
> Repro Steps:
> # Start RU with client components in INSTALL_FAILED state.
> # RU starts as there are no pre-req check that fails when components are in
> INSTALL_FAILED state.
> # However RU is aborted when upgrading components in INSTALL_FAILED state
> # This was because RU did not know how to handle upgrade of INSTALL_FAILED
> components
